Transaction 212113febfed388429ef9551cb1aa19fc79f5acc476587eaf6baf8548f807031
1 Input
1 Output
-
212113febfed388429ef9551cb1aa19fc79f5acc476587eaf6baf8548f807031:0
- value
- 12770539
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 561cd62236ccef3a0d992b3a1f57cfeb3c7bfc42 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18rKf6CvhHC41URbG97UFZsgqTAk5BJGwB